KEDGE Business School is a vibrant business school with four campuses in France (Paris, Bordeaux, Marseille and Toulon), two in China (Shanghai and Suzhou) and one in Africa (Dakar). KEDGE Business School offers an international environment, which includes 12,600 students (25% foreign students), 183 full-time faculty members (44% of whom are international) and 275 international academic partners. Ranked 33rd amongst European Business Schools and 37th worldwide for the Executive MBA by the Financial Times, KEDGE Business School is AACSB, EQUIS and AMBA accredited and a member of the French Conférence des Grandes Écoles.

Conditions of employment
Our PhD positions are fully funded for a period of up to 4 years. Appointed PhD candidates are employees of KEDGE Business School and will receive a salary of approx. EUR 1900 per month gross, including health care benefits. Following the 3-paper model, a PhD thesis at KEDGE consists of three related academic papers, which are presented at leading conferences and ultimately submitted to high-quality academic journals. The PhD programme offers extensive training in research methods; students are also encouraged to regularly attend research seminars. Our PhD students furthermore are expected to teach on undergraduate and masters’ courses, which are normally undertaken in English. Training in pedagogy is also available. Successful candidates are appointed on a full-time basis for a duration of up to four years. The PhD positions are intended to start 1 September 2020.
